Review: Xikar Tech Quad Flame Lighter

Ask yourself: How many jet flames do you need to toast the foot of a cigar? If your instincts said "four" then you might want to get your hands on the new Xikar Tech Quad Flame Lighter coming out this summer. It's a powerful four-flame torch lighter that's impressively swift at lighting a cigar—and its combined flame strength and durable construction make it great for the outdoors.
While a four-flame lighter might seem excessive indoors, any cigar enthusiast who's tried to light up outside knows that a bit of wind can make on-the-go cigar smoking a real challenge. Lesser lighters just won't stay lit. But the Xikar Tech Quad Flame Lighter has the muscle to prevail: One tap of the thumb ignition and the auto-open lid springs aside and four high-powered flames jump upwards. This impressive display of fire is supplied by an oversized, transparent fuel tank that makes the Quad Flame a valuable tool to take with you on outdoor adventures.

In testing the Quad Flame Lighter, which measures about three inches tall, we found the solidly constructed unit to fit comfortably in the hand. Most importantly, however, is that it had no misfires. The ignition button produced flames every time it was pressed. The flame-adjustment wheel on the bottom of the lighter was easy to use and sufficient at raising and lowering the height of the jet flames. While the lighter does not claim to be windproof, our tests indicated that the lighter did provide better wind resistance than the average single-flame torch lighter when used outside on a moderately breezy day.
The Xikar Tech Quad Flame Lighter is part of the Tech family of lighters, which also come in single, double and triple flame varieties. All are equipped with the line's hallmark metal flip cap lid, giant fuel tank and large, flame-adjustment wheel.

The Quad Flame is priced at $74.99 and is officially launching this summer at the 2016 International Premium Cigar & Pipe Retailers trade show.
